FAQ
When choosing a graphing calculator for high school, look for key features such as a large display, preloaded functions for algebra and calculus, the ability to plot graphs, and compatibility with standardized tests. Many students benefit from calculators that support programmable functions and have a user-friendly interface.
Most graphing calculators from major brands are permitted on standardized tests such as the SAT, ACT, and AP exams, but it's important to check the specific model against the test's approved calculator list. Always review the official guidelines before test day.
Yes, graphing calculators are versatile tools that can be used in science courses like physics and chemistry for data analysis, scientific notation, and complex calculations. Some models also support functions useful in statistics and engineering classes.
Most graphing calculators come preloaded with essential math and graphing functions. However, some advanced models allow you to install additional apps or software for expanded capabilities, such as programming or data collection. Refer to the manufacturer's website for available downloads.
Many graphing calculators include comprehensive user manuals and built-in tutorials. Additionally, there are online resources, video tutorials, and user forums that offer step-by-step guides and tips. Your teacher or classmates may also provide helpful advice on mastering your calculator.
